Ingredients
Potato Skins
– 4 medium russet potatoes
– 2 tbsp olive oil or melted butter
– Salt and pepper, to taste
### Cheeseburger Filling
– 1 lb ground beef
– ½ small onion, finely chopped
– 2 cloves garlic, minced
– 1 tbsp Worcestershire sauce
– ½ tsp salt
– ½ tsp black pepper
– 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ese, divided
– 6 slices cooked bacon, crumbled
Toppings
– Sour cream
– Chopped pickles or relish
– Green onions
– Optional: ketchup or mustard drizzle
Instructions
1. Preheat oven to 400°F. Bake potatoes for 45–60 minutes until fork-tender. Let cool slightly.
2. Cut each potato in half. Scoop out most of the flesh, leaving a ¼-inch border. Brush skins with oil or butter, season, and bake cut-side down for 10–15 minutes until crisp.
3. Meanwhile, cook ground beef in a skillet over medium heat. Add onion, garlic, Worcestershire, salt, and pepper. Cook until browned.
4. Stir in crumbled bacon and ½ cup cheese.
5. Fill each potato skin with beef mixture. Top with remaining cheese and return to oven for 5–7 minutes.
6. Top with sour cream, pickles, green onions, or other favorite toppings. Serve warm!
Notes
– Save scooped potato flesh for mashed potatoes or potato soup.
– Freeze unbaked filled skins for easy reheating later.
